First Round:
1. They weren't invited. They were sent there by the Ministry of Magic to hunt down Black. Dumbledore even said he had no control over their presence.
2. I loved it. Plus, what better way to hide and still keep close to the pulse of all that is happening in the magic world?
3. Harry wouldn't think it was actually himself across the lake. So when he saw someone that he briefly thought looked like himself, he assumed the family resemblance was because it was his father. Just as a note, there are four names that are on that Marauder's Map. They are Padfoot, Wormtail, Moony, and Prongs. They represent the four friends and refer to their alter identities once they transform to their animal selves... Wormtail is Pettigrew b/c he is a rat with the worm-looking tail; Padfoot is Sirius Black because he becomes a dog with the pad feet that dogs have; Moony is Professor Lupin because he becomes a wolf under the moonlight (as a side note, Lupin is similar in nature to the species name for a wolf which is "lupus"); and Prongs is Harry's father because his patronus, like Harry's, is a buck with the pronged antlers.
